A player has achieved the impossible in Diablo IV by dealing “infinite damage” with his attack.

- Advertisement -

Diablo 4 presents players with a number of challenges throughout their journey. Most of them have already been overcome by the community, but there was still one that seemed insurmountable. That goal was to reach a level of damage that the game couldn’t represent with a number. But now it’s finally been done. Influencer Rob2628 has surpassed that goal with his Barbarian. The main reason he was able to do so seems to be that his build is buggy, which became apparent when he took so much damage that the game stopped counting it.

- Advertisement -

His main tool was the enhanced ability of his spikes, which deal damage back to those who try to destroy him. The instances are tough to start with, but once you get going, there’s hardly anyone who survives, as Rob2628 demonstrates in his run through the hardest dungeon available. Apparently, this damage was possible mainly because this was a test version of the game, so it’s unlikely that the community will see this madness again next month when the Vessel of Hatred expansion hits PC, PlayStation, and Xbox consoles.
